Arts Integration Continuing this year a PTA initiative to support arts integration into each classroom during the year.  Specialists use the fine and performing arts as primary pathways to learning. The goal of arts integration is to increase knowledge of a general subject area while concurrently fostering a greater understanding and appreciation of the fine and performing arts. Specialists work with teachers to highlight a curriculum area and provide teacher training. Karen Harris

eScrip/Giant A+: Janney participates in retail store fundraising programs: eScrip (that works with Safeway and other national retailers) and The Giant A+ Rewards. Once supporters have registered their grocery cards and/or debit/credit cards, merchants in each program donate a percentage of the purchases made directly to the school. Dianne Bock

Library Volunteers: A team of volunteers supports the school librarian during classroom visits by reading stories and assisting students with research and word processing.  Volunteers also assist with such library operations as shelving, data entry, book repair, and book circulation. Marla Viorst

Musicals Each winter, Janney 4th and 5th grade actors, singers, and dancers perform in a musical production. The production relies on many parents, teachers, and school staff members to assist with auditions and rehearsals, designing costumes, applying makeup, creating props and sets, selling tickets, getting publicity, and more. Productions at younger grade levels happen throughout the year as part of a musical theater after school class. Parent participation is essential for these productions as well. Karen Harris
